C:\Users\Administrator\AppData\Local\electron-builder\Cache如图: 安装的问题,同样的应当用cnpm或者手动换为国内的源来进行下载。 在执行npm run dist命令之后,由于还要到github外网下载很多东西,所以依然会卡死或者甚至报错 electron-v1.8.2-win32-x64.zip下载失败 进入官网,然后将该包直接下载下来,然后放置到项...
网络问题:由于 npm 仓库的网络延迟,导致安装失败。 依赖冲突:项目中可能存在与 Electron 其他依赖不兼容的模块。 权限问题:在一些系统中,安装包可能需要更高的权限。 示例代码 在安装 Electron 前,确保你的项目已经初始化。可以使用以下命令创建新的项目: mkdirmy-electron-appcdmy-electron-appyarninit-y 1. 2. ...
删除和旧镜像相关的参数 npmconfigdeletehomenpmconfigdeleteelectron_mirrornpmconfigdeletedisturlyarnconfigdeletesass-binary-site 2. 但是我们把所有的删掉后,虽然不报ssl和dns解析的错误了,会报electron更新失败的错误: error G:\c-private\lize-tools-pc\node_modules\electron: Command failed. Exit code: 1 Com...
安装命令: yarn add --dev electron 然后安装失败: 准备找找之前写的文章,看看当初有没有解决,结果就发现当初自己也没解决啊😭,是用来npm下载掉的… (标准的逃避可耻但有用) 解决过程 这次不能再姑息了,一定要用yarn安装成功。 electron官网上其实也有过安装失败的一些推测,可能是由于网络原因导致的。但是没有...
1.进入 node_modules/electron文件下, 编辑install.js文件 2. 修改downloadArtifact这段代码, 添加淘宝镜像地址https://npm.taobao.org/mirrors/electron 原来downloadArtifact部分: 修改后: downloadArtifact({ version, artifactName:'electron', force: process.env.force_no_cache=== 'true', ...
通过yarn包管理器安装electron-webpack时,报如下错误: 问题原因 开始以为是下载源的问题,但是切换到淘宝源后依然无法解决问题,还是报这个问题。并且自己通过npm包管理器安装时,也会报同样的错误。 后来在网上找了一圈,发现是【HTTPS 证书验证失败】导致的。
在electron中找不到path.txt 根本原因是因为downloadArtifact函数下载的太慢了 方法一: 前往淘宝镜像库:https://npm.taobao.org/mirrors/electron/ 下载对应的版本,然后在node_modules\electron\下创建dist文件夹,将下载的压缩包解压进刚刚创建的dist。 在node_modules\electron\中创建path.txt,内容为electron.exe ...
深入分析发现,这可能是由于electron官方镜像速度较慢导致的网络问题。为了解决此问题,我决定为yarn设置新的淘宝镜像地址。然而,尽管成功设置了镜像地址,证书验证问题依旧存在,表明`yarn config set strict-ssl false`配置并未生效。最后,我通过设置环境变量临时禁用了SSL验证,解决了证书验证问题。但又...
重新安装$ sudo cnpm install --save-dev electron B74998:test-electron xxx$ sudo cnpm install --save-dev electron ✔ Installed 1 packages ✔ Linked 132 latest versions [1/1] scripts.postinstall electron@* run "node install.js", root: "/Users/v_lishaohai/Desktop/study/electron/demo/test...